Second Chance-Collaboration
He was searching for the author of 'A Reader of the Stars,'
the woman he still loved, who'd published her memoirs.
She wrote of wishing she could see inside a crystal ball,
to find the man she loved, who was handsome and tall.
He said to himself, "She's the woman of your dreams,"
and hated losing her when love fell apart at the seams.
Now, he'd ask her, "Will you allow me to enter your life?
Please say 'yes' and I vow to cherish you as my wife."
He would treat her as a treasure; a princess, no doubt.
With words of love for her, from the rooftops he'd shout,
"Darling, could you ever love again, someone just like me?"
On bended knee, he'd offer a diamond ring with his plea.
